Frequently Asked Questions about i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F

Within the last 12 months, i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F paid a dividend of A$0.95. For the next 12 months, i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F is expected to pay a dividend of A$0.95. This corresponds to a dividend yield of approximately 2.64%.
The dividend yield of i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F is currently 2.64%.
i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F pays biannually dividends. This is paid in the months of July, January.
The next dividend for i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F is expected in July.
Within the last 10 years, i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F has paid dividends in 7 of them.
Dividends of A$0.95 are expected for the next 12 months. This corresponds to a dividend yield of 2.64%.
The largest sectors of i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F are Health Care, Information Technology, Consumer Staples.
There are currently no known stock splits for i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F.
To receive the last dividend of i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F on January 18, 2023 in the amount of A$0.30 you had to have the stock in your portfolio before the ex-day on January 6, 2023.
The last dividend was paid on January 18, 2023.
In 2022, dividends of A$0.92 were paid by i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F.
Dividends from i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F are paid in Australian Dollar.
In iShares Edge MSCI World Minimum Volatility ETF, the United States, Japan and Australia are represented as the three largest countries.
